The Quillbird public REST API paginates all list endpoints using cursor-based pagination. Each response includes a next_cursor field; pass it as the cursor query parameter to fetch the following page. Page size defaults to 50 and caps at 200 via the limit parameter. Cursors expire after 24 hours, so release smoke tests should not cache them between runs. Note that the internal mirror endpoint used for release verification bypasses the public gateway and requires its own credential, which is provided below.

service key, fawip-bajef: kto11_Qt5wZK9vdNC

Handover — Vexler partner SFTP drop

Ownership moves to you today. Drop runs hourly from Vexler's end into the intake bucket via the relay host. Watch for zero-byte files; their exporter flakes on Mondays. Creds live in the ops vault, path noted in the runbook. Vault auto-seals after 48h idle. Support escalations go to the on-call rotation, not me. If the vault is sealed when you need it, unseal with the recovery passphrase below.

recovery phrase for tadug-fafof: zorwyn-kasion

### Escalation — Sweepster Orphan Cleanup

If Sweepster flags more than 500 orphaned volumes in one pass, don't panic — it's usually a stale tag filter, not an actual leak. Pause the sweep with `sweepster halt`, snapshot the candidate list, and ping the infra channel. If the list includes anything tagged `release-locked`, that's a hard stop: nothing gets deleted until the Calderon Cloud platform leads sign off. For sign-off requests or anything you can't untangle within an hour, email the sweeper owners.

alerts address for kafog-haweg: wendor.ulaael@zemvarworks.internal

# Extracts translatable strings from Fernwick UI templates.
# Runs in CI only; no network access, no shell-outs.
# Output is a sorted JSON catalogue, diffed against the
# committed baseline to catch injected or dropped keys.
# Escaping is applied before write, so raw template input
# never reaches the catalogue verbatim. Review the escape
# table below if keys change. The extraction build is pinned to the token below.

pipeline stamp: htk31_f769b577b3028a4e9958e5bb8d1259a